REMARKABLE DEATH-RATE.

-WASHINGTON, /February 28^ ■*■ The remarkable death-rate on American railways is exemplified: by figures for the months of July, Axigust, and September last. Two hundred and, one persons were killed, and. 4000 injured. The death rate shows a consider-, able decrease compared, with the corresponding period for 1910.
